When selecting diapers for elderly individuals, it’s essential to consider several factors that impact comfort, protection, and usability. Proper fit prevents leaks and skin irritation, while absorbency levels should match the severity of incontinence. Ease of application is critical for caregivers and users with limited mobility. Material quality influences skin health, and cost considerations ensure the product remains sustainable long-term. Keeping these factors in mind helps avoid common mistakes like choosing overly bulky options or those that lack adequate odor control.Absorbency Level
Understanding the amount of urine the diaper can handle is vital. Light to moderate incontinence may require thinner, discreet designs, whereas heavy incontinence benefits from high-capacity products like overnight briefs. Choosing the wrong level of absorbency can lead to leaks or unnecessary bulk, so match the product to the individual’s needs. Consider whether the user needs overnight protection or daily use, and opt for a product that can handle the expected volume comfortably.
Fit and Comfort
A well-fitting diaper reduces leaks and skin irritation. Pay attention to waist size, leg cuff design, and whether the product offers adjustable tabs or pull-up styles. Comfort is especially important for elderly users who may be sensitive to tight elastic or rough materials. It’s wise to select options with soft, breathable fabrics that facilitate airflow, preventing rashes and discomfort over prolonged wear.
Ease of Use
For users with limited mobility or caregivers assisting with changing, ease of application is key. Pull-up styles mimic regular underwear and are simple for independent users, while diapers with side tabs can make adjustments easier for caregivers. Features like resealable tabs and resealable tapes help in managing frequent changes smoothly. Avoid overly complicated designs that might cause frustration or delays during urgent changes.
Material Quality and Skin Health
Choosing products made with skin-friendly, hypoallergenic materials minimizes irritation. Look for diapers with moisture-wicking layers and breathable fabrics, which help prevent rashes and infections. Avoid products with harsh chemicals or strong fragrances that could cause allergic reactions. Prioritizing quality materials supports skin integrity over long-term use, especially for sensitive skin types common among elderly users.
Cost and Value
While higher-priced options often deliver better performance and comfort, they may not be necessary for every user. Bulk packs or subscription options can reduce overall costs, making premium products more affordable. Conversely, budget-friendly choices can be suitable for short-term needs or less frequent use. Balance your budget with the level of protection required to ensure consistent, reliable performance without overspending on features that may not be needed.
Frequently Asked Questions
How do I choose the right size for elderly diapers?
Selecting the correct size is crucial for preventing leaks and skin issues. Measure the waist and hips accurately, then consult the sizing chart provided by the manufacturer. A diaper that is too tight can cause discomfort and skin irritation, while one that is too loose increases the risk of leaks. Many brands offer adjustable or multiple size options, which can help fine-tune the fit for maximum comfort and protection.
Are pull-up diapers better than tab-style diapers for elderly users?
Pull-up diapers resemble regular underwear and are often preferred for their ease of use and discreet appearance. They are ideal for active users who can manage their own changes. Tab-style diapers, on the other hand, are generally easier for caregivers to adjust and secure, especially for users who have difficulty standing or sitting. The choice depends on the user’s mobility, independence, and personal preference.
What features should I prioritize for overnight protection?
Overnight diapers should have high absorbency capacity, leak-proof barriers, and a snug fit to prevent leaks while sleeping. Breathable materials and odor control are also important for comfort and freshness. Consider products designed specifically for overnight use, such as heavy or extra-absorbent briefs, which can hold larger volumes of urine over extended periods without discomfort.
How often should elderly diapers be changed to prevent skin issues?
Frequent changes are recommended to maintain skin health, typically every 2-4 hours or as soon as the diaper is soiled. Prolonged exposure to moisture can cause skin irritation, rashes, or infections. For individuals with sensitive skin or those prone to pressure ulcers, more frequent changes and skin inspections are advisable. Using high-quality, breathable materials also helps mitigate skin problems associated with extended wear.
Can I use regular adult underwear instead of specialized diapers?
Regular adult underwear may not provide sufficient absorbency or leak protection for incontinence needs, especially severe cases. Specialized adult diapers are designed with multiple layers, absorbent cores, and leak guards to handle larger volumes and prevent accidents. If incontinence is mild and infrequent, high-quality absorbent underwear might suffice, but for ongoing or heavy incontinence, dedicated diapers offer significantly better protection.
